Globally, as of 6:30 pm BJT on Tuesday, there have been 28,918,900 confirmed cases of coronavirus, including 922,252 deaths, reported the World Health Organization.

The outbreak has now claimed 198,141 lives in the US, the most of any country, with a total of 6,689,792 infections, according to a tally by the 1Point3Acres virus tracker as of 6:30 pm BJT on Tuesday.

India has confirmed a total of 4,930,236 COVID-19 cases, raising the number of deaths to 80,776.

Confirmed cases of COVID-19 in Brazil have increased to 4,345,610 with 132,006 deaths, Johns Hopkins reported.

Russia has confirmed 1,069,873 cases of COVID-19, with the number of deaths at 18,723.

Peru has reported 729,619 COVID-19 cases and 30,710 deaths from the virus so far.

Colombia's confirmed cases have increased to 721,892, with the number of deaths at 23,123, according to the JHU virus tracker.

It is followed by Mexico with 71,049 deaths from 671,716 infections.

South Africa has recorded 650,749 confirmed cases and 15,499 deaths.

The coronavirus pandemic has claimed 29,848 lives in Spain, bringing the total number of infections to 593,730.

A total of 565,446 people in Argentina have tested positive for COVID-19, with the death toll at 11,667.
